各位前辈,《java 编程思想》这本书怎么样啊,都说是圣经级别的啊,现在有第 5 版吗,可是当当、天猫都没搜到,另外,还有哪些好的 java 方面的书比较好的可以推荐吗,正好趁着寒假充电

2015-12-13 22:43:40 +08:00
 creatorYC
10450 次点击
所在节点    Java
62 条回复
nellace
2015-12-14 15:39:14 +08:00
寒假想多充点就多充充电,不想充就开开心心玩玩吧,其实在校少玩一点效率更高一点,毕竟毕业以后再也没有这样的假期挥霍了
woaixq
2015-12-14 15:56:29 +08:00
压泡面,非常好用,把电脑垫高也可以~
pelloz
2015-12-14 16:03:55 +08:00
Effect Java 必看,稍微有点项目经验再看,你会发现这是一本神书。寒假把这本书看完理解好就不错了
hkongm
2015-12-14 16:11:19 +08:00
是圣经,读过几遍,后来送给一个实习生了
creatorYC
2015-12-14 17:42:02 +08:00
@woaixq 哈哈,这是书的作者额外送给我们的功能,不收费额
creatorYC
2015-12-14 17:42:42 +08:00
@woaixq 这个机灵抖得好啊
creatorYC
2015-12-14 17:43:05 +08:00
@pelloz 嗯嗯,认真研读
armstrong
2015-12-14 19:51:54 +08:00
楼主以后如果写 Java 的话,肯定会用到 Apache Commons 系列类库和 Goggle 的 Guava 类库,可以在 Github 上把这些项目的代码 clone 下来,慢慢看。不过你如果没用过这些类库的话,可能还感觉不到他们的方便之处。
dawnLuke
2015-12-15 04:36:25 +08:00
@creatorYC 联系我啦 fd465a2e@opayq.com
dawnLuke
2015-12-15 04:39:20 +08:00
@creatorYC effective java 不适合初学。但是 think in java 应该是适合初学的 读起来跟小说一样 不怎么费劲
NSSimacer
2015-12-15 11:05:14 +08:00
这些书在不同阶段读会有不同的收获,读起来的感觉也可能不一样。

像 Core Java 和 Thinking In Java 这些书虽然都比较厚,但是有基础的话,翻起来还是挺快的。

Effective Java 和讲重构之类的书适合有一定的 Java 编程经验再读。
taozi
2015-12-15 11:43:22 +08:00
如果楼主会编写 java 代码只是没有系统的学习过 java 的话,我觉得可以把 Java in a nutshell 找来看(最新版涵盖 java8 ,不过貌似没有中文版)。以这本书可以作为大纲,觉得不甚明了的地方,具体的可以参考 core java 。这样把 java 基础系统的学习一遍后,然后再可以看看 Effective java 了。至于 Thinking In Java 我觉得有时间还是可以翻翻的。
creatorYC
2015-12-15 12:27:26 +08:00
@taozi 就是写过一点代码,自己也写过简单的博客小网站,但老是有只是在堆代码的感觉,所以想看看深层次的东西,进阶一下
creatorYC
2015-12-15 12:28:51 +08:00
@armstrong Apache Commons 的用过不少,不过都是简单的使用而已,没有具体的看过源码...
honam
2015-12-15 14:14:38 +08:00
买了四年,一直在龟速看,现在看了四分三了好开心...不过,内容感觉有点旧了
taozi
2015-12-15 16:23:39 +08:00
@creatorYC 我个人觉得 Thinking in java 被神化了吧,就是一本内容比较老的入门书。既然楼主有基础,可以直接看看 Effective java ,查漏补缺下就行。主要的还是多写代码。
creatorYC
2015-12-15 18:01:35 +08:00
@honam 等第五版,哈哈
alafeizai
2015-12-15 18:48:57 +08:00
@xiaowangge 只有 2 篇博客哈。。
caliven
2015-12-15 20:58:09 +08:00
「深入理解 Java 虚拟机」可以看看
kslr
2015-12-15 21:16:25 +08:00
@ooTwToo 请问出了没有?如果价格合适我正需要。

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://tanronggui.xyz/t/243291

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X